Container does not detect definition error with non-Dependent generic beans

Assertion 3.1.g states:
"If the managed bean class is a generic type, it must have scope @Dependent. If a
managed bean with a parameterized bean class declares any scope other than @Dependent, the
container automatically detects the problem and treats it as a definition error, as
defined in Section 12.4, "Problems detected automatically by the
container""
see
org.jboss.jsr299.tck.tests.definition.bean.genericbroken.GenericManagedBeanTest.testNonDependentGenericManagedBeanNotOk()
